Cask. Unsworth’s Yard brewery, Cartmel. Mostly clear gold. Thick, creamy, white head. Nose has sweet grain. Some lemon pith. Yeasty bread. Taste is light sweet, with a lemon rind bitterness. Light body. Fairly thin. Fine carbonation. Moderate bitterness to finish. Ok.

On cask at Alexanders, Kendal. Appearance - golden with a decent head. Nose - flowers, herbs, custard. Lemon. Taste - lemon and lime. Light biscuit. Palate - light bodied with a creamy texture and a long dry finish. Overall - good example of the style.
